3 THEOREMA. 7 PROPOSITIO.
Si punctum firmitudinis centrum gravitatis ſit penden-
tis columnæ, quemcunque ei ſitum dederis, ſervat.
*DATVM*. A B C D columna eſto, ejusq́;
29[Figure 29] centrum E firmum fixumq́ue, quo de linea
E F ſit ſuſpenſa, axis G H ad horizontem I K
parallelus.
*QVAESITVM. * Columnam
A B C D, quemcunqueſitum dederis, reti-
nere demonſtrandum eſt.
DEMONSTRATIO.
Datæ columnæ (E puncto immoto) alium
affingamus ſitum, quam prius, ut ſecundâ
hæc figurâ exhibetur, producaturq́ue F E, ut in L uſque, ſecans A B in M,
eq́ue ſuo ſitu, ſi quidem poſſit, emoveatur, &
ſegmentum M L D A, vel
M L C B nutet deſcendatq́ue.
Atqui duo iſta ſegmenta magnitudine æqua-
lia ſunt, ideoq́ue æquilibria, æquilibrium
30[Figure 30] igitur alterum ponderoſius eſſe altero conſe-
quens erit, quod prorſus abſurdum eſt.
Co-
lumna igitur ſitum ſuum obtinet, aut alium
quemvis, quicunque ei tributus fuerit.
*CONCLVSIO. * Si itaque firmitudinis
punctum columnæ centrum fuerit, quemli-
bet datum ſitum ſervabit.
